Fragrant hyacinths and muscari (commonly known as grape hyacinth) in shades of blue fill an elegant, 7” white compote.
Care: Keep in a bright spot in your home, rotating as needed to encourage straight stems. When the top inch of soil is dry, add water. After blooms fade, dispose of bulbs or plant them in your garden.
Caution: some people are sensitive to the skin of the hyacinth bulb. Watch hands well after handling, or use gloves.
